#697053 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#697053 is composed of 41.2% red, 43.9%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 74.5 degrees, a saturation of 14.9% and a lightness of 38.2%. #697053 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2e0a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#697053

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0b08 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#697053

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65695b is the less saturated color, while #94c300 is the most saturated one.
